打造个性化AI语音助手的步骤
随着科技的不断发展,人工智能技术已经深入到我们生活的方方面面。其中,AI语音助手作为人工智能的重要应用之一,越来越受到人们的关注。打造一个个性化AI语音助手,不仅能够满足用户的需求,还能提升用户体验。本文将为您详细介绍打造个性化AI语音助手的步骤。
一、明确目标用户群体
在打造个性化AI语音助手之前,首先要明确目标用户群体。不同的用户群体对AI语音助手的需求和期望是不同的。以下是一些常见的用户群体:
智能家居用户:这类用户对AI语音助手的需求主要集中在智能家居设备的控制上,如家电、照明、安防等。
办公用户:这类用户对AI语音助手的需求主要集中在日程管理、会议提醒、文件搜索等方面。
娱乐用户:这类用户对AI语音助手的需求主要集中在音乐、电影、游戏等方面。
生活服务用户:这类用户对AI语音助手的需求主要集中在购物、餐饮、出行等方面。
明确目标用户群体后,可以针对其需求进行功能设计和优化。
二、收集用户需求
在明确目标用户群体后,接下来要收集用户的具体需求。以下是一些收集用户需求的方法:
调研:通过问卷调查、访谈等方式,了解用户对AI语音助手的需求和期望。
用户反馈:收集用户在使用现有AI语音助手时的反馈意见,了解其痛点。
竞品分析:分析同类产品的功能和特点,找出差异化的需求。
竞争对手分析:了解竞争对手的用户需求,为自己的产品提供借鉴。
三、设计功能模块
根据用户需求,设计AI语音助手的功能模块。以下是一些常见的功能模块:
语音识别:实现用户语音输入的识别和理解。
语音合成:将文本信息转换为语音输出。
语义理解:理解用户意图,实现智能对话。
智能推荐:根据用户兴趣和行为,推荐相关内容。
智能控制:实现对智能家居设备的远程控制。
语音交互:实现用户与AI语音助手的自然对话。
个性化定制:根据用户喜好,提供定制化的功能和服务。
四、选择合适的开发平台
选择合适的开发平台对于打造个性化AI语音助手至关重要。以下是一些常见的开发平台:
云平台:如阿里云、腾讯云、华为云等,提供丰富的API和工具,方便开发者快速搭建AI语音助手。
开源平台:如TensorFlow、PyTorch等,提供深度学习框架,支持自定义模型。
商业平台:如科大讯飞、百度AI等,提供成熟的语音识别、语音合成等技术。
五、数据采集与训练
打造个性化AI语音助手需要大量的数据。以下是一些数据采集与训练的方法:
数据采集:通过语音识别、自然语言处理等技术,从用户对话中采集数据。
数据标注:对采集到的数据进行标注,如意图识别、实体识别等。
模型训练:使用标注好的数据,训练AI语音助手的模型。
模型优化:根据实际应用效果,不断优化模型,提高准确率和鲁棒性。
六、测试与迭代
在AI语音助手开发过程中,测试与迭代至关重要。以下是一些测试与迭代的方法:
单元测试:对各个功能模块进行测试,确保其正常运行。
集成测试:将各个功能模块集成在一起,进行整体测试。
性能测试:测试AI语音助手的响应速度、准确率等性能指标。
用户测试:邀请目标用户群体进行测试,收集反馈意见,不断优化产品。
七、发布与推广
在AI语音助手开发完成后,需要进行发布与推广。以下是一些发布与推广的方法:
官方渠道:通过官方网站、社交媒体等渠道发布产品信息。
合作伙伴:与智能家居、办公、娱乐等领域的合作伙伴进行合作推广。
用户口碑:鼓励用户分享使用体验,形成良好的口碑效应。
媒体报道:邀请媒体进行报道,提高产品知名度。
总之,打造个性化AI语音助手需要明确目标用户群体、收集用户需求、设计功能模块、选择合适的开发平台、数据采集与训练、测试与迭代以及发布与推广等多个步骤。通过不断优化和迭代,打造出满足用户需求的个性化AI语音助手,为用户提供更加便捷、高效的服务。
猜你喜欢:智能对话